Diabetes is a life-threatening condition, there is no cure at the present time, and it can often result in long term related health problems.
The best way to reduce the threat of getting diabetes mellitus is to implement a well-balanced way of life.
If you go along with the guidelines listed below, you will reduce the odds of contracting diabetes, and if you are already diabetic, reduce the damage that it can do.
1. Diet.
Yes, it might appear obvious, but if you eat well balanced meals then you will be less at risk than individuals who don t do it.
Experts give advice to people who are at risk of diabetes that if they don t want to contract this disorder they should:
i. Consume lots of vegetables and fruit specially those that are lower in carbohydrates.
ii. Consume more whole grain foods like beans and grains.
iii. Enjoy more high protein foods, like poultry and fish.
2. Weight loss.
Being overweight is also a substantial issue for people who are prone to diabetes mellitus. Experts say that those who are fat have a far larger chance of contracting diabetes as it can cause insulin resistance.
3. Keep Fit.
Many diabetes experts believe that people who adopt an healthy exercise routine have a far lowered chance of contracting diabetes mellitus. For more information, have a look at : a guide to diabetes … where they discuss the advantages of frequent exercise in some detail.
4. Smoking and Drinking
Drink and cigarettes are also highly dangerous for those who are prone to diabetes mellitus. It isn’t that drink and cigarettes help to cause diabetes, but that they can damage the same parts of the body that diabetes does.
